The Kiryu saga concludes! Three Kaiju legends come together in a final battle in GODZILLA: TOKYO S.O.S. Godzilla rages against Tokyo while Kiryu (aka Mechagodzilla) is on standby as politicians decide whether or not to relaunch. Meanwhile, Mothra and the Shobijin show up at the home of Chujo, an ex-soldier who met Mothra in the 1960s. The Shobijin ask for the Prime Minister to take Kiryu to the sea, so the bones of the original Godzilla it's built on can be laid to rest, but Japan doesn't believe Mothra will fight in Kiryu's place. All of this sets the stage for a titanic battle between Godzilla, Mothra and Kiryu that will decide the future safety of Japan. As with its prequel GODZILLA AGAINST MECHAGODZILLA, GODZILLA: TOKYO S.O.S. was scored by Michiru Oshima, who returned with an equally-brilliant score to shake the pillars of heaven. Oshima not only brings back her thrilling themes for Godzilla and Kiryu but also introduces a wonderfully versatile theme for Mothra, stunning in ethereal and melancholic modes, and of course, ‘Mothra's Song’ appears. There's a genuine emotional resonance to Oshima's music amongst the fire and the fury, with beautiful choral material homaging Akira Ifukube's original music from 1954. It's a triumph from Michiru Oshima and a thrilling musical climax to the great Kiryu saga! - Charlie Brigden

GODZILLA AGAINST MECHAGODZILLA - ORIGINAL MOTION PICTURE SOUNDTRACK 2XLP 
Terror in Tokyo! Godzilla is back and is determined to cause as much damage as possible in GODZILLA AGAINST MECHAGODZILLA. After the Big G delivers a crippling blow to the JXSDF (Japanese Xenomorph Self-Defence Force), the government decides to build a new weapon to defeat Godzilla. Their solution: Kiryu, aka Mechagodzilla, a metal monster packed with all the firepower needed to put Godzilla down. But things go awry when Kiryu malfunctions and turns on the JXSDF, thanks to its use of the original Godzilla's DNA. Can they get back control and put an end to the Big G? 
 
Selected to score GODZILLA AGAINST MECHAGODZILLA was Michiru Ōshima (GODZILLA VS MEGAGUIRUS, STAR WARS: VISIONS), who brought an exciting and heroic musical aesthetic to the film. Employing the Moscow Symphony Orchestra, Ōshima's music sounds as enormous and powerful as the kaiju themselves, with a new menacing theme for Godzilla that uses the lower registers to bring across his immense force. In contrast, Ōshima's theme for Kiryu uses high brass for an almost superheroic feel, with both themes working beautifully in counterpoint to each other when the two titans have their rumble. As scary as it is thrilling, Michiru Ōshima's GODZILLA AGAINST MECHAGODZILLA is one of the most significant scores to emerge from the hallowed halls of Toho.  
- Charlie Brigden

GODZILLA VS. KING GHIDORAH - ORIGINAL MOTION PICTURE SOUNDTRACK LP 
Japan faces its ultimate doom as Godzilla's deadliest foe is back in GODZILLA VS KING GHIDORAH. Visitors from the 23rd Century arrive with grave news; Godzilla will destroy Japan in the future. Time travelling back to when Godzilla was born, they prevent the birth, but something goes wrong, as when they come back to the present day, the monstrous three-headed King Ghidorah is on the rampage instead. A secret conspiracy is soon unmasked, and only one outcome will save the country: Godzilla must return!  
 
GODZILLA VS KING GHIDORAH saw the return of legendary composer Akira Ifukube to the series, his first since 1975's TERROR OF MECHAGODZILLA. He showed no sign of slowing down, providing a thrilling and muscular score dominated by the presence of the two headliners. Godzilla's theme and fanfare are presented beautifully by Ifukube, along with the terrifying material for Ghidorah. The composer also wonderfully integrates earlier music from RODAN and KING KONG VS GODZILLA that - along with his terrific new music - results in a musical monster throw-down for the ages. No one knew Godzilla better than Akira Ifukube, and GODZILLA VS KING GHIDORAH proves it.   
-Charlie Brigden

"Have you ever been walking in a forest and stopped to try some fruit growing on a tree or bush? You may think twice after MATANGO, a tense psychological horror from Ishirō Honda, director of GODZILLA (1954). Released in Japan in 1963 to immediate controversy over the similarity of the makeup effects to the victims of Hiroshima and Nagasaki, MATANGO is about a group of men and women driven to violence and murder after being shipwrecked, only for them to fall victim to the horrifying mutated monsters that inhabit the island they discover.

Released overseas under the titles ATTACK OF THE MUSHROOM PEOPLE and FUNGUS OF TERROR, MATANGO's eerie musical score was composed by Japanese classical composer Sadao Bekku and is as hypnotic and surreal as the film's shocking climactic sequences. Bekku's music takes much of its inspiration from jazz, from the irreverence of a cue for the shipwrecking storm to the haunting trumpet that hails the first sight of the desolate island. Much of the score is about form, colour and texture, and it often offers dissonant patches that wind up the tension between the men and women and snakey woodwinds that highlight the insidious nature of the island's true inhabitants. MATANGO is a masterpiece."
-Charlie Brigden

"Earth's greatest defender is back! Join Mothra Leo, the latest legendarily humongous member of the Heterocetera family, as he carries on the legacy in REBIRTH OF MOTHRA II, directed by Kunio Miyoshi with a story by the great GODZILLA creator Tomoyuki Tanaka. An ancient sea monster named Dagahra awakens due to mass ocean pollution and Leo needs to stop it, but it can only do so with a trio of children who discover the ancient sunken civilisation of Nilai-Kanai, who created the monstrous aqua-kaiju. Also in the mix is the Mothra Twins' evil sister Belvera and the adorable little creature Ghogo, who befriends the children and acts as their protector. Returning to score REBIRTH OF MOTHRA II is Toshiyuki Watanabe, who brings back the exciting and lyrical orchestral style he established in the previous film, starting with a thrilling heroic theme for Mothra Leo that encaptures the nobility of the kaiju and his representation of nature. A threatening brass march for Dagahra expresses his vicious might, while a gorgeously ethereal and somewhat melancholic theme represents Princess Yuma and the ancient kingdom of the Nilai-Kanai. But the best is saved for last, a beautifully versatile theme for the creature Ghogo that encapsulates what Mothra as a character is all about: loving and protecting the Earth."
-Charlie Brigden

"Mothra 3 The trilogy ends! Everyone's favourite Lepidopteran defender of Earth returns for a humongous climactic battle in REBIRTH OF MOTHRA III, this time fighting the Toho universe's greatest villain: King Ghidorah! Directed by Okihiro Yoneda, the picture sees Mothra Leo and the Elias sisters join forces with a young boy after Ghidorah kidnaps hundreds of children so he can siphon off their power. For Mothra to defeat his most ferocious foe, he must travel to the past while all three sisters must make up and join their special daggers together to give Mothra the ultimate power and defeat Ghidorah.

As with the previous two films, scoring REBIRTH OF MOTHRA III is Toshiyuki Watanabe, who once again brings his powerful orchestral style to the series. His music soars with pounding drums and heroic brass as Mothra travels to the Cretaceous period to attack Ghidorah in his younger form before transforming into the beautifully lyrical and ethereal tones of 'Haora Mothra' as the Elias transfer their power to Mothra. Ghidorah himself is given a suitably malevolent motif for low brass, but Watanabe brings back his triumphant Mothra theme in spectacular fashion as our hero is reborn as Armor Mothra, bringing a sensational musical end to the trilogy. Mothra oh Mothra, our guardian angel!"
-Charlie Brigden
